Sanket Sinha, Managing Director & Chief Executive Officer, Global Asset Management at Lighthouse Canton, will deliver a keynote address at SuperReturn Asia 2026, scheduled for 28 September to 1 October 2026 at Marina Bay Sands Convention Centre, Singapore.
SuperReturn Asia is the premier event in the private markets calendar, bringing together over 2,500 private markets professionals, including more than 1,200 limited partners and 1,000 general partners, alongside private wealth representatives and institutional investors from 50+ countries. The agenda spans private equity, venture capital, private credit, secondaries, liquidity solutions, and AI and deep tech, with a mix of plenary discussions, specialist summits, and structured networking sessions.

Sanket will deliver the keynote address titled "Asia's Credit Moment: Divergence, Geography, and the New Capital Base." The keynote will examine:
- How Asia's credit markets are shifting from broad regional bets toward specialised, market-specific strategies
- Where the region's growing capital base is heading, and which geographies are attracting the most attention
- What structural divergence across Asia's credit markets means for capital deployment going forward
- How institutional investors should be positioning for this new phase of the region's credit story
